Saudia to launch Tabuk-Cairo flight
TABUK, February 24, 2015
Saudi Arabian Airlines (Saudia), the flag carrier of the kingdom, is expanding its international operations with the launch of a direct flight from the city of Tabuk to Cairo, Egypt on April 15.
The airline will operate thrice-weekly flights to the Egyptian capital, aiming to serve passengers traveling between the two countries, especially during peak seasons.
Abdul Mohsen Junaid, executive vice president, Commerce, said: “Tabuk would be the sixth station in the kingdom to operate direct flights to Cairo, after Riyadh, Jeddah, Dammam, Madinah and Abha.”
“This flight is an addition to Saudia’s operations to Egypt, including Alexandria and Sharam El-Sheikh,” Junaid said.
Saudia carried a record 1.8 million passengers between the two countries last year on 9,956 scheduled and additional flights, reflecting on the growing Saudi-Egyptian relations. – TradeArabia News Service
